Location Situated in a quiet, green and family-friendly residential area in Son en Breugel. The Vressel woods and the Sonse Heide nature reserve with the Oud Meer are within walking distance. This varied natural area between Son and Best features woodland, heathland, drifting sand dunes and water, making it ideal for walking, cycling and running. Excellent accessibility is provided by the nearby A50 motorway, with convenient connections to the A2 and A59. Eindhoven is easily reached by car, bicycle and public transport.
